Additionally, you’ll notice that bitcoin price will vary somewhat between different Exchanges, but not entirely. The specific liquidity on an Exchange affects its price. Since offer and demand are not processed in a centralized manner, but rather on an Exchange by Exchange basis, so is the resulting price. Arbitrage plays an important role in flattening out the proce difference between Exchanges.

Of course supply and demand themselves will depend themselves on multiple factors such as regulation, news, sentiment, global and local economics, buzz, and so forth, pushing or retracting demand in the process.
